Ronson working with Rufus Wainwright
Published Friday, Feb 4 2011, 10:12 GMT | By Robert Copsey

The hitmaker, who who has previously teamed up with Amy Winehouse and Lily Allen, said he already has a "great idea" for the record, which is slated for release later this year.
"I'm working on the new Daniel Merriweather record as well as The Black Lips and Rufus Wainright," he told the Daily Star.
"I don't want to jump the gun, but I've an idea for Rufus. He's great for a producer as he offers such a great palette."
Rufus's last effort All Days Are Nights: Songs for Lulu peaked at number 21 on the UK album chart last March.
The 'Bike Song' star is currently producing Culture Club's comeback LP.
